Basic Lawn Care / Fertilizer Program

Application

Product Date
1ST Application Fertilizer w/ Slow Release + Crabgrass Preventer Mid March thru April
2ND Application Fertilizer w/ Slow Release +Broadleaf Weed Control Late April - Early May
3RD Application Slow Release Fertilizer Also: Insecticides if needed* Late June - Early July
4TH Application Same as #2 above, or Slow Release Fertilizer Late August - September
5TH Application Higher Potash blend w/ Slow Release Nitrogen October / November

There are many variables regarding which fertilizer analysis is ‘best’ to use. Amount and type of fertilizer used depends on soil type, available irrigation…or precipitation, and the total amount of Nitrogen required per season to reach optimal turf quality. It is usually best to use fertilizer with ‘Slow Release Nitrogen’. Always read and follow label instructions for fertilizers, combination fertilizer and pesticide products, and other lawn pest control products. Above dates are estimates depending on weather. Apply all fertilizers to dry turf and water in, except granular ‘weed & feed’ applications.

* Merit for grub prevention is applied now. Insecticides and fungicides are applied during summer months when infestation(s) are present.
